> On Friday 20 May 2011, salaheddine elharit wrote: > > Ok thank you so much for all advice > > This might help you a bit, too: > > <?php > $spool = "/var/spool/asterisk/outgoing/"; # outgoing callfile folder > > $filename = "asterisk-" . date("U") . "-" . $_SERVER["REMOTE_PORT"] . > ".call"; > # this should end up being fairly unique. (if logging to a database with > an > # auto increment field, you can also use mysql_insert_id() as a unique > # reference) > > $src = ... ; # source extension > # you can determine this based on $_SERVER["REMOTE_ADDR"], which is the > # IP address of the requesting client, by looking up in an array or a > database > $ctxt = ... ; # context > $dest = ... ; # destination number > # you probably want to get this from $_REQUEST > > $callfile = "Channel: SIP/$src\nContext: $ctxt\nExtension: $dest\nPriority: > 1\nCallerId: $src\n"; # line break added by email, not used in real life! > if ($fh = fopen("/tmp/$filename", "w")) { > fwrite($fh, $callfile); > fclose($fh); > system("mv /tmp/$filename $spool"); > } > else { > die("Call file creation failed"); > }; > ?> > > -- > AJS > > Answers come *after* questions. > > -- > _____________________________________________________________________ > -- Bandwidth and Colocation Provided by http://www.api-digital.com -- > New to Asterisk?
